dc.descriptionAbstract: A rapid method for automated classification of oranges in living trees by size has been developed. It is based on image processing with correlation analysis in the frequency domain. This technique has the advantage of being a direct measurement method that automatically identifies and counts oranges for quality control. Calibration was performed using standard image with known orange sizes. Orange’s sizes, ranging from less then 2 cm to over 10 cm in diameter have been automatically recognized and successfully measured. Error was not larger than 1.4%. In addition, practical examples of use of the method for determining characteristics of oranges are presented.
